Output 71b826c5de9a165e625d979db43391ba229c62d3e472670f68fdfa7da6c18a9e:2

value
4250780
script pubkey
OP_0 OP_PUSHBYTES_20 e27cddb800fe630342bb14d2e19691b70594e101
address
bc1quf7dmwqqle3sxs4mznfwr953kuzefcgp5445d9
transaction
71b826c5de9a165e625d979db43391ba229c62d3e472670f68fdfa7da6c18a9e
spent
true